Atlanta – June 1, 2011 –
The Rainmaker
Group, a world leader in automated profit
optimization
software and revenue
management
services for the multifamily housing and hospitality industries,
announced that
its new corporate offices have earned the prestigious 2011 Gold Design
Award
from the Georgia Chapter of the American Society of Interior
Designers. Carson Guest, Rainmaker’s design firm, won the
highly competitive award in the category of corporate offices over
10,000
square feet.

We also used white marker board paint on entire walls to encourage creativity and imagination.” Sustainable design demonstrates that beauty can mean business Carson Guest’s light-filled,
green design includes
durable, sustainable finishes dramatically highlighted by bright, yet
indirect long-life
lighting. Floor-to-ceiling windows with views to nature
abound, and corridors are curved to create added dimension.
Rainmaker’s corporate logo in the reception
lobby is a unique visual signature backed by translucent resin that
glows with
the sunlight during the day and is front-lighted in the evening.
Glass walls with frosted film accents and
soothing eggshell paint are interrupted by pops of color from vivid
green
accents, art, and other distinctive design details. John Guest
